Growing Fitness and Wellness Industry
The fitness and wellness industry in the GCC region is expanding rapidly, contributing to the growth of the bioimpedance analyzers market. As more individuals engage in fitness activities and seek to improve their overall health, the demand for accurate body composition analysis tools is increasing. Gyms, fitness centers, and wellness clinics are incorporating bioimpedance analyzers into their services to provide clients with detailed insights into their health metrics. The market for fitness-related technologies is projected to reach $1 billion by 2026, indicating a robust growth trajectory. This trend suggests that the bioimpedance analyzers market will benefit from the rising interest in personal health and fitness, as consumers seek reliable methods to track their progress.
Advancements in Bioimpedance Technology
Recent advancements in bioimpedance technology are significantly impacting the bioimpedance analyzers market. Innovations such as improved sensor accuracy, enhanced data analytics, and user-friendly interfaces are making these devices more appealing to both healthcare professionals and consumers. The introduction of portable and compact bioimpedance analyzers is also facilitating their use in various settings, including home health monitoring. As technology continues to evolve, the market is likely to see an influx of new products that cater to diverse consumer needs. This evolution may lead to a projected market growth of 10% annually, as enhanced features attract a broader audience and encourage widespread adoption of bioimpedance analyzers.
Rising Prevalence of Obesity and Related Disorders
The bioimpedance analyzers market is significantly influenced by the rising prevalence of obesity and related disorders in the GCC region. With obesity rates climbing to alarming levels, healthcare professionals are increasingly utilizing bioimpedance technology to assess body composition and provide tailored health recommendations. The World Health Organization has reported that obesity rates in the GCC countries have reached approximately 35%, necessitating effective monitoring solutions. This alarming trend is driving demand for bioimpedance analyzers, as they offer valuable insights into fat distribution and muscle mass. As healthcare providers focus on preventive measures, the bioimpedance analyzers market is expected to witness substantial growth in response to the urgent need for effective obesity management.
Increasing Demand for Non-Invasive Health Monitoring
The bioimpedance analyzers market is experiencing a surge in demand for non-invasive health monitoring solutions. As consumers become more health-conscious, there is a growing preference for devices that provide accurate body composition analysis without the need for invasive procedures. This trend is particularly pronounced in the GCC region, where healthcare providers are increasingly adopting bioimpedance technology to enhance patient care. The market is projected to grow at a CAGR of approximately 8% over the next five years, driven by the rising awareness of chronic diseases and the need for regular health assessments. Consequently, the bioimpedance analyzers market is likely to expand as more individuals seek convenient and reliable methods to monitor their health metrics.
Government Initiatives to Promote Health Technologies
Government initiatives in the GCC region are playing a pivotal role in promoting the adoption of advanced health technologies, including bioimpedance analyzers. Various health ministries are investing in programs aimed at improving healthcare infrastructure and encouraging the use of innovative diagnostic tools. For instance, funding for research and development in medical technologies has increased, which is expected to bolster the bioimpedance analyzers market. With an estimated investment of over $500 million in health technology advancements, the market is poised for growth as healthcare facilities upgrade their equipment to meet modern standards. This supportive environment is likely to enhance the accessibility and utilization of bioimpedance analyzers across the region.
